ntfsprogs(1M)

Name

ntfsprogs - list of NTFS tools

Synopsis

ntfsprogs

Description

ntfsprogs is the name of a suite of NTFS utilities based around a shared library. The tools are available for free and come with full source code. The tools are listed below.

mkntfs(1M)

Create an NTFS filesystem.

ntfscat(1M)

Dump a file's content to the standard output.

ntfsclone(1M)

Efficiently clone, backup, restore, or rescue NTFS.

ntfscluster(1M)

Locate the files that use the specified sectors or clusters.

ntfscmp(1M)

Compare two NTFS file systems and report the differences.

ntfscp(1M)

Copy a file to an NTFS volume.

ntfsfix(1M)

Check and fix some common errors, clear the log file, and make the operating system perform a thorough check next time it boots.

ntfsinfo(1M)

Show information about NTFS or one of the files or directories within it.

ntfslabel(1M)

Show, or set, an NTFS filesystem's volume label.

ntfsls(1M)

List information about files in a directory residing on an NTFS.

ntfsmount(1M) (not a SunOS man page)

Read-write NTFS user space driver.

ntfsresize(1M)

Resize NTFS without losing data.

ntfsundelete(1M)

Recover deleted files from NTFS.

Authors

Authors

The tools were written by Anton Altaparmakov, Carmelo Kintana, Cristian Klein, Erik Sornes, Giang Nguyen, Holger Ohmacht, Lode Leroy, Matthew J. Fanto, Per Olofsson, Richard Russon, Szabolcs Szakacsits, Yura Pakhuchiy, and Yuval Fledel.
